2.5'2 <br /> <br />· TUESDAY, OCTOBER 22° 1991 <br /> <br />A regular semi-monthly meeting of the Council of the City of Martinsville, <br />Virginia, with Mayor Allan McClainpresiding, was held Tuesday, October 22, <br />1991, in the Council Chamber, City Hall, beginning at 7:30 P.M. All members <br />of Council were present: Allan McClain, Mayor; Alfred T. Groden, Vice-Mayor; <br />George B. Adams, Jr.; L. D. Oakes; and Clyde L. Williams. <br /> <br />After. the invocation, followed by Mayor McClain's cordial welcome to visitors <br />present, Council approved the minutes of its October 10, 1991, meeting as <br />circulated. <br /> <br />Under business from the floor, Council heard from O'Shane Tarptey of 624 <br />Fayette Street regarding the amount of money he had to pay to have the <br />electricity restoredat his residence after he missed the cut-off date for <br />payment by~e day. It was noted that, under the City's Terms and Conditicns <br />for Electric Service, when a customer does not pay his utility bill before <br />the due date he will receive a "pink" cut-off notice that has a 10% penalty <br />added to the bill and allows for payment to be made within ten days. If the <br />customer does not pay by the cut-off date, the service is terminated and he <br />must pay a deposit fee (if he doesn't have adeposit on file) which is double <br />the charge for the two highest months in the previous 12-month period, a $20 <br />reconnection fee, plus the actual cost of the monthly bill past due (includ- <br />ing a 10% penalty) in order to have service restored.
